CLANHS(1)	    LAPACK auxiliary routine (version 3.2)	     CLANHS(1)

NAME
       CLANHS  -  returns the value of the one norm, or the Frobenius norm, or
       the infinity norm, or the element of largest absolute value of  a  Hes‐
       senberg matrix A

SYNOPSIS
       REAL FUNCTION CLANHS( NORM, N, A, LDA, WORK )

	   CHARACTER NORM

	   INTEGER   LDA, N

	   REAL	     WORK( * )

	   COMPLEX   A( LDA, * )

PURPOSE
       CLANHS	returns	 the value of the one norm,  or the Frobenius norm, or
       the  infinity norm,  or the  element of	largest absolute value	 of  a
       Hessenberg matrix A.

DESCRIPTION
       CLANHS returns the value
	  CLANHS = ( max(abs(A(i,j))), NORM = 'M' or 'm'
		   (
		   ( norm1(A),	       NORM = '1', 'O' or 'o'
		   (
		   ( normI(A),	       NORM = 'I' or 'i'
		   (
		   (  normF(A),		 NORM  =  'F',	'f',  'E' or 'e' where
       norm1  denotes the  one norm of a matrix (maximum  column  sum),	 normI
       denotes	the   infinity	norm  of a matrix  (maximum row sum) and normF
       denotes the  Frobenius  norm  of	 a  matrix  (square  root  of  sum  of
       squares).   Note	 that	max(abs(A(i,j)))   is  not a consistent matrix
       norm.

ARGUMENTS
       NORM    (input) CHARACTER*1
	       Specifies the value to  be  returned  in	 CLANHS	 as  described
	       above.

       N       (input) INTEGER
	       The  order of the matrix A.  N >= 0.  When N = 0, CLANHS is set
	       to zero.

       A       (input) COMPLEX array, dimension (LDA,N)
	       The n by n upper Hessenberg matrix A; the part of A  below  the
	       first sub-diagonal is not referenced.

       LDA     (input) INTEGER
	       The leading dimension of the array A.  LDA >= max(N,1).

       WORK    (workspace) REAL array, dimension (MAX(1,LWORK)),
	       where LWORK >= N when NORM = 'I'; otherwise, WORK is not refer‐
	       enced.
